Iris Scanner vs. Face Recognition: Are both the same or not?
Because each person’s iris pattern is unique, biometric iris recognition checks the client’s eyes. Face recognition verifies the customer’s face, including lips, eyes, and facial pattern. Both scans have the same objective: to verify the user’s legitimacy. They guarantee prompt services and restrict access to the area they are situated in to only authorized consumers.
